Andrew,

 

I may have a VDO one that will do the job. I'm not certain that the face is absolutely identical but it'll be pretty damn close. The main difference from the original gauge is it's fixing method. Instead of a "U" clamp with a couple of nuts, the actual body of the gauge is threaded and there is an outer sleeve that screws over this thread.
